From d9cf4fe91c21eb045cc4718d73cf2210b945d273 Mon Sep 17 00:00:00 2001 From: Aleksander Morgado Date: Wed, 27 Mar 2013 15:14:34 +0100 Subject: iface-modem-3gpp: let plugins ignore facility locks Plugins may decide which facility locks can be completely skipped from the list being checked. --- src/mm-iface-modem-3gpp.c | 9 +++++++++ 1 file changed, 9 insertions(+) (limited to 'src/mm-iface-modem-3gpp.c') diff --git a/src/mm-iface-modem-3gpp.c b/src/mm-iface-modem-3gpp.c index 329ac1f7..6ec07a68 100644 --- a/src/mm-iface-modem-3gpp.c +++ b/src/mm-iface-modem-3gpp.c @@ -2148,6 +2148,15 @@ iface_modem_3gpp_init (gpointer g_iface) FALSE, G_PARAM_READWRITE)); + g_object_interface_install_property + (g_iface, + g_param_spec_flags (MM_IFACE_MODEM_3GPP_IGNORED_FACILITY_LOCKS, + "Ignored locks", + "Ignored facility locks", + MM_TYPE_MODEM_3GPP_FACILITY, + MM_MODEM_3GPP_FACILITY_NONE, + G_PARAM_READWRITE)); + initialized = TRUE; } -- cgit v1.2.3-70-g09d2